Wheatmore was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their fourth straight defeat. They were a single run away from ending the streak, but they lost a 4-3 heartbreaker at the hands of the Southern Lee Cavaliers. That's two games in a row now that the Warriors have lost by just one run.
Wheatmore's loss dropped their record down to 6-11. As for Southern Lee, they are on a roll lately: they've won three of their last four games. That's provided a nice bump to their 13-6 record this season.
Wheatmore will square off against Southern Alamance at 1:00 p.m. on Wednesday. As for Southern Lee, they will welcome Southwestern Randolph at 7:00 p.m. on Wednesday.
